Gieseke Rips Four Doubles, as Team Wild Claims Game Two

TUCSON, Ariz.--- The bats exploded for both sides, but was junior Sawyer Gieseke's game-high four doubles that made the difference, as Team Wild claimed its second straight win in the series, defeating Team Cats 62-36 in game two of the Wild vs. Cats Fall World Series, Friday night out at Hi Corbett Field.

Team Wild now holds an overall 101-57 advantage over Team Cats heading into Sunday's series finale. The score is based upon Arizona baseball's unique scoring system and is a running total over the three combined games. For traditional baseball scorers, Team Wild took down Team Cats 8-5 in game two.

Gieseke led all batters with four knocks in five plate appearances (all doubles), while he drove in a game-high three runs, while scoring one. Senior Justin Behnke, Zach Gibbons, and freshman Alfonso Rivas all produced multi-hit performances while combining for four runs scored. Rivas is now 6-of-10 from the plate in the series.

On the pitching side of things for the Wild, the freshman trio of Matt Flynn, Austin Rubick, and Trent Johnson combined to limit the offensive success for Team Cats, as no pitcher surrendered more than two earned runs on the night.

For Team Cats, it was a balanced offensive attack, as seven of eight batter collected at least one hit, while Cody Ramer, Jared Oliva, Ryan Aguilar, and Casey Bowman all recorded three knocks.

Aguilar led the way, going 3-of-5 from the dish with a team-high two RBI, while Ramer drove in a run and scored twice.

Freshman Randy Labaut pitched well in relief for Team Cats, as he tossed a scoreless inning and recorded a punch out.

The two sides will wrap up the 2015 Wild vs. Cats World Series, Sunday at 1 pm MST out at Hi Corbett Field.
